When her train finally resumed its journey, Kat knew she wouldn’t make it to London in time.  So when it reached the next station, forlornly she got off. 

As she stood on the platform waiting for a train to take her back home, Kat went through all the reasons that auditioning was a stupid idea anyway.  She wasn’t pretty enough.  She didn’t have star quality.  Her musical style was ethereal and quirky.  How could she fit into some generic five-piece girl group?

But, they’d called her for an audition hadn’t they?  Someone had seen her clip on YouTube and gone yes, we want you.   We think you’ve got something.  Plus it gave her such a thrill to read the positive comments people posted about her clip online.

“Great vibe.” 

“This rocks.”

“Ur a superstar Katya K.” 

“Keep posting more tunes.”

Kat had deleted that one and blocked the user – kenny_slick. 

Maybe she should try and get to London after all.  She looked across the station and saw her train was still there, held up because of all the earlier chaos.

What would her free-spirited mama have done…?

Big nosed bitch?  Or superstar Katya K? 

Her mama would definitely have leapt on that train and headed for the bright lights.  Kat swung round, colliding straight into a businessman behind her.

“Oi!  Watch it!”

“Sorry.  Sorry,” said Kat, as she scrambled past him.

She ran up the stairs and over the bridge, all the while the train doors were still open.  If she could just get to the first carriage.  Panting, she raced down the stairs on the other platform.  As she leapt down the final three steps and bolted towards the train, there was a beeping sound and the doors slammed shut.  She was too late.

As the train slowly edged out of the station, Kat could have kicked herself.  Why had she got off the train in the first place?  Why couldn’t she just have believed in herself for once? 

Kat knew she could wait for another train to London, but the moment had passed and she was back to seeing herself as plain old Katya Kaminski with the wonky nose and fuzzy hair.

She looked up at the information board.  The next train back home was in six minutes.  Slowly Kat trudged back over the bridge, suddenly missing her mama more than ever.
